Are you getting these requests vie a email of within Facebook? If its the former its trying to trick you to login via a fake link. If its the latter probably someone you know has had their email/address book hacked then the spammer has opened a Facebook account and used facebook's 'let us access your address book and automatically bother everyone you've ever received an email from' function
